What is a Sauna?

A sauna is a controlled high temperature environment designed to heat the body, raise core circulation and stimulate deep sweating. Core sauna types include:

  • Traditional Dry Sauna – heated with electric or wood sauna heater

  • Infrared Sauna – infrared heating panels directly warm the body

  • Barrel Sauna – cylindrical sauna structure for faster air heat cycling

  • Commercial Spa Sauna – high traffic wellness center installatio

Sauna Safety: Use Sauna Rated Parts Only

Inside a sauna, all components must be high temperature rated.

This includes all lighting, speakers, wiring, insulation, switches and internal hardware.

Normal household electronics are not designed for sauna heat and humidity — they will degrade very fast, fail prematurely and may create serious safety risks.
